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 927 8057674
3670413757 31999907029
3670413757 31999907029
9560 866397664 7475969 45 796
All about undefined
Interested in learning more?
3670413757 31999907029
9560 866397664 7475969 45 796
See more
4445 48000016140 369
22528749 107905454 1890451763 7101251
See more
2475139 2516434
018 1742 244
See more